The cost to install a pocket door in Chattanooga ranges from $540 to $2,680, with most homeowners paying around $1,340. Your actual cost depends on several factors specific to your home and the Chattanooga market.
The South generally offers lower labor costs, though fast-growing metro areas are seeing rates climb. Year-round building seasons mean more consistent pricing and availability.
Pocket door installation in Chattanooga generally does not require a permit for standard installations. Check with your local building department if your project involves panel work or structural changes.

While possible for experienced homeowners, pocket door installation involves significant complexity. In Chattanooga, you may still need a licensed pro for permits and inspections. DIY could save $560–$720 in labor.
